Issues
- some lights are not occluded.
- minor transparency issues (possibly related to occlusion)
Lens flares visible through solid objects, no surprise here. Additionally, silhouette of objects that emanate light is visible in the outlining hue of the same type of object, when both are in one line of sight. I don't know what's happening and how to explain it with words, so here is the picture:
Played for about 30 minutes, saving works, not seeing other issues. A little bit faster than typical UE game, but shader compilation stutter is just as noticeable.
Coalesced editing
Coalesced_INT.bin
can be freely edited with any hex editor, this game doesn't check for changes.
MaxSmoothedFramerate:
4D 00 61 00 78 00 53 00 6D 00 6F 00 6F 00 74 00 68 00 65 00 64 00 46 00 72 00 61 00 6D 00 65 00 52 00 61 00 74 00 65
LensFlares - 2 search results are True, change both to False:
4C 00 65 00 6E 00 73 00 46 00 6C 00 61 00 72 00 65 00 73
MotionBlur - 2 search results are True, change both to False:
4D 00 6F 00 74 00 69 00 6F 00 6E 00 42 00 6C 00 75 00 72
Skip intro
Rename or delete:
FateGame/Movies/Xbox360/Airtight_TitleScreen.bk2
FateGame/Movies/Xbox360/Square_TitleScreen.bk2
Then remove line 1027 from FateGame/Xbox360TOC.txt
:
550164 0 ..\FateGame\Movies\Xbox360\Square_TitleScreen.bk2 0
